Publicación:
A tool to assess the communication cost of parallel kernels on heterogeneous platforms

dc.contributor.authorRico Gallego, Juan Antonio
dc.contributor.authorMoreno Álvarez, Sergio
dc.contributor.authorDíaz Martín, Juan Carlos
dc.contributor.authorLastovetsky, Alexey L.
dc.contributor.orcidhttps://orcid.org/0000-0002-4264-7473
dc.contributor.orcidhttps://orcid.org/0000-0002-8435-3844
dc.contributor.orcidhttps://orcid.org/0000-0001-9460-3897
dc.date.accessioned2024-11-15T09:10:07Z
dc.date.available2024-11-15T09:10:07Z
dc.date.issued2020
dc.descriptionThe registered version of this article, first published in “The Journal of Supercomputing, , 2020, vol. 76", is available online at the publisher's website: Springer, https://doi.org/10.1007/s11227-019-02919-1 La versión registrada de este artículo, publicado por primera vez en “The Journal of Supercomputing, , 2020, vol. 76", está disponible en línea en el sitio web del editor: Springer, https://doi.org/10.1007/s11227-019-02919-1
dc.description.abstractEnsuring applications to achieve an efficient usage of resources and fast execution time in the complex current heterogeneous high-performance computing platforms is a paramount problem. Essential efforts to reach the goal are the optimal partitioning of the data space between the processes composing a typical task/data-parallel application, and their right mapping and deployment on the platform. The computational and communication performance modeling describing the platform and the application behaviors is an increasingly recognized approach. This paper discusses the utility of the τ–Lop analytic communication performance model in facing these issues and contributes with a practical symbolic computation tool that represents, manipulates and accurately evaluates the formal communication cost expression derived from a hybrid kernel. We identify a set of scenarios where the tool could be applied, provide with both basic and advanced use examples and evaluate the tool on real-life kernels.en
dc.description.versionversión final
dc.identifier.citationRico-Gallego, J.A., Moreno-Álvarez, S., Díaz-Martín, J.C. et al. A tool to assess the communication cost of parallel kernels on heterogeneous platforms. J Supercomput 76, 4629–4644 (2020). https://doi.org/10.1007/s11227-019-02919-1
dc.identifier.doihttps://doi.org/10.1007/s11227-019-02919-1
dc.identifier.issn0920-8542
dc.identifier.urihttps://hdl.handle.net/20.500.14468/24384
dc.journal.titleThe Journal of Supercomputing
dc.journal.volume76
dc.language.isoen
dc.page.final4644
dc.page.initial4629
dc.publisherSpringer
dc.relation.centerFacultades y escuelas::E.T.S. de Ingeniería Informática
dc.relation.departmentLenguajes y Sistemas Informáticos
dc.rightsinfo:eu-repo/semantics/openAccess
dc.rights.urihttp://creativecommons.org/licenses/by-nc-nd/4.0/deed.es
dc.subject12 Matemáticas::1203 Ciencia de los ordenadores ::1203.17 Informática
dc.subject.keywordscommunication performance modelingen
dc.subject.keywordsheterogeneous parallelismen
dc.subject.keywordsheterogeneous partitioning and mappingen
dc.titleA tool to assess the communication cost of parallel kernels on heterogeneous platformsen
dc.typeartículoes
dc.typejournal articleen
dspace.entity.typePublication
relation.isAuthorOfPublication3482d7bc-e120-48a3-812e-cc4b25a6d2fe
relation.isAuthorOfPublication.latestForDiscovery3482d7bc-e120-48a3-812e-cc4b25a6d2fe
Archivos
Bloque original
Mostrando 1 - 1 de 1
Cargando...
Miniatura
Nombre:
MorenoAlvarez_Sergio_2020AToolToAssesTheCommu.pdf
Tamaño:
1.94 MB
Formato:
Adobe Portable Document Format
Bloque de licencias
Mostrando 1 - 1 de 1
No hay miniatura disponible
Nombre:
license.txt
Tamaño:
3.62 KB
Formato:
Item-specific license agreed to upon submission
Descripción: